About Ceragon

Carrier-class microwave with deep North American carrier deployment.

Ceragon (headquartered in Israel with significant North American presence) is one of the largest carrier-class microwave point-to-point manufacturers globally, with deployment across cellular carriers, broadcast networks, government microwave systems, and ISP backhaul projects worldwide. The IP-20 platform is the current product family: IP-20C compact all-in-one terminal, IP-20E Ethernet-focused, IP-20N node-based modular for high-capacity multi-link sites, IP-20G all-outdoor design, and IP-20S split-mount where the indoor unit handles processing and the outdoor unit handles RF. The platform spans licensed microwave bands from 6 GHz through 42 GHz, supports XPIC dual-polarization, ACM adaptive modulation, and the SDH plus PDH plus Ethernet payload mix typical of carrier backhaul installations.

Which IP-20 variant should I specify?

IP-20C compact all-in-one is the typical choice for single-link sites where the indoor and outdoor unit are combined in one outdoor enclosure (lower install cost, simpler). IP-20E is Ethernet-focused with strong throughput for IP-only backhaul. IP-20N node-based modular is for high-capacity sites with multiple links sharing common indoor processing (typical at large cellular sites). IP-20G all-outdoor places everything outdoor and works well where indoor space is limited. IP-20S split mount has the indoor unit in a shelter or rack for protected processing and the outdoor unit at the dish. Can you help with FCC Part 101 licensing for a Ceragon microwave link?

Yes for the basics. FCC Part 101 licensing requires path profile work, frequency coordination through a coordinator (Comsearch, Micronet, or similar), and the FCC license application itself. We coordinate path profile and frequency coordination handoff with Ceragon engineering and the appropriate frequency coordinator. The FCC license itself is held by the licensee. Typical end-to-end timeline from path profile request to license grant is 4-8 weeks.

Ceragon versus SIAE versus Aviat: how do they compare?

All three are carrier-class microwave PtP manufacturers and feature parity is generally close at the carrier tier. Ceragon has the broadest global deployment and strong North American cellular carrier presence (often the default for carrier backhaul scaling 4G to 5G). SIAE Microelettronica (Italian) is particularly strong in European cellular and growing North American adoption. Aviat Networks (US-based) has deep North American carrier installations and strong service organization. Will IP-20 support our 5G backhaul migration?

Yes for the higher-capacity IP-20N and current IP-20 firmware. 5G backhaul typically requires multi-Gbps capacity per link, low latency, and high availability. IP-20N node-based platforms with XPIC dual-polarization and high-order modulation (1024QAM or higher) on wider channels deliver multi-Gbps per link. For 5G mid-haul where capacity demands are even higher, Ceragon also has E-band and high-capacity Gbps-class platforms beyond IP-20 baseline.
